    Detailed Product Overview

    The HIOKI BT4560-60 Battery Impedance Meter is engineered for precise measurement of lithium-ion battery cell (LiB) impedance, covering a broad frequency range from 0.01 Hz to 10 kHz and a DC voltage measurement range of ±5 V. The extended upper frequency limit enables advanced analysis of high-frequency impedance behavior, allowing observation of SEI-related phenomena and separator characteristics for a more comprehensive understanding of electrochemical processes. With selectable measurement ranges of 3 mΩ, 10 mΩ, and 100 mΩ, the instrument is well suited for evaluating large-capacity cells with extremely low internal resistance, such as those used in traction batteries and energy-storage systems.

    A maximum test current of 1.5 A rms is available in the 3 mΩ range, with proportionally reduced values in higher ranges. The minimum impedance resolution of 0.1 µΩ ensures highly accurate characterization even at very low impedances. The four-terminal-pair measurement configuration minimizes errors caused by lead resistance, magnetic coupling, and eddy currents. Building on the classical four-terminal method, it uses shielded current and voltage pairs, as commonly implemented in LCR meters and impedance analyzers, to further reduce coupling and phase errors at higher frequencies. The instrument supports cell voltage measurements of either polarity within ±5 V, meaning connection polarity does not affect the measurement results. 

    Applications and Electrochemical Impedance Spectroscopy (EIS)

    The BT4560-60 is used for evaluating large-capacity cells in traction batteries and stationary energy-storage systems. In production, it supports impedance verification during the final stages of cell assembly. In pack and module manufacturing, it enables incoming inspection and cell qualification to ensure performance consistency before installation. In research and development environments, it is used to investigate impedance behavior, diffusion characteristics, and degradation mechanisms associated with state of health (SoH). The extended 10 kHz limit further supports high-frequency analysis of interfacial processes and dielectric responses. The instrument is also ideal for cell matching, where cells are grouped according to impedance and capacity to achieve uniform performance in assembled packs.

    When connected to a PC—typically via USB—the BT4560-50 can perform electrochemical impedance spectroscopy (EIS). The included software manages frequency sweeps, collects impedance data, and displays Nyquist and Bode plots for interpretation. This configuration is well suited for laboratory use, where detailed impedance measurements are performed directly from a computer. Data can also be exported to ZView® for advanced equivalent-circuit modeling. 

    Perfect for System Integration

    Equipped with LAN and RS-232C interfaces and an EXT. I/O port for trigger and control signals, the BT4560-50 integrates seamlessly into automated test systems. It can communicate with external controllers or multiplexing systems for sequence control, making it highly adaptable for production lines and quality-assurance environments. LabVIEW drivers and example programs are provided for PC-based automation and custom software development. The instrument can also be operated directly by a PLC or paired with HIOKI SW1001 / SW1002 multiplexers and other switching solutions, offering a practical platform for automated battery test setups.

    The BT4560-50 performs impedance measurement using a low-level AC signal that does not disturb the electrochemical state of the cell, allowing accurate evaluation without heating or degrading high-capacity or newly developed cell types. A range of measurement cables is available for both laboratory and production use. The L2002 Kelvin clip lead is designed for laminated cells such as pouch types, while the L2003 Kelvin pin lead is suitable for cylindrical or mounted cells, including those used in automated fixtures.
